Kinds of Welder’s Certificates

Although the AWS’ normal CW card paves the way for the majority of jobs, many industries will require their specific certification. Examples of the most-widely used of them are highlighted below.

  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for welders that handle boiler and pressure containers
  • Certified Welder Certificates to become a Certified Welder
  • American Petroleum Institute Certification for individuals that deal with pipelines in the energy field
  • SCWI and CWI Certifications for inspectors and senior inspectors

The below table illustrates labor and wage projections for professional welders in New Hampshire through the end of the decade.

New Hampshire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 970 1,020 5% 30
New Hampshire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$27,400 $41,200 $57,300

Source: O*Net Online
